Opening Ceremony Pre-Fall, Part 2: The Prints!
We've talked about the shapes—OC favorites like babydolls and flared skirts—and the fabrics—lurex, fur, and satin—so now it's time to think prints. Here's the second batch of Opening Ceremony's pre-Fall collection, starring our custom Aztec print. Based on the woven patterns found in Argentinean blankets, the stripe-and-stitch motif appears on collared dresses, blouses, and the billow pant (our airy cropped palazzo, back by popular demand from spring). The knits follow suit with the jagged triangles woven into jacquard cardis and stretchy mini skirts.
